Aide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) - Medical Oncology
Join a dedicated healthcare team in the heart of the Midwest region, providing compassionate and essential patient care in a supportive environment. This role offers the opportunity to work closely under the guidance of licensed nurses, delivering direct care to patients in a medical oncology setting.
Under the supervision of a licensed nurse (RN, LPN, or shift manager), the Patient Care Assistant (PCA) delivers fundamental patient care services, ensuring safety and comfort.
- Adhere to established safety protocols including infection control, safe patient handling, and timely communication of patient condition changes to licensed nurses.
- Perform basic care tasks such as monitoring vital signs, glucometer checks, assisting with toileting, feeding, bathing, and mobility activities.
- Operate within hospital policies to support quality outcomes and patient safety.
- Collaborate effectively with nursing staff to meet patient needs and respond promptly to requests, enhancing patient experience.
- Accurately document all patient care activities to aid clinical decision-making.
- Communicate relevant patient information to team members to improve care quality and outcomes.
High school diploma or GED preferred.
At least one year of experience and certification as a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) is preferred.
If uncertified or with less than one year of experience, attendance at a PCA training academy is required. American Heart Association Basic Life Support (BLS) certification must be obtained within the first 90 days of employment; training is provided.
This role requires considerable mental focus and physical activity including lifting up to 35 lbs., standing, walking, and various movements such as pushing, pulling, stooping, and reaching.
Frequent exposure to infectious and communicable diseases through blood and bodily fluids is expected. Occasional encounters with hostile individuals may occur.
